Ordinals
beta
Sat 1350121115674822
decimal
330048.1115674822
degree
0°120048′1440″1115674822‴
percentile
64.29148176952171%
name
ehbwpcvknrf
cycle
0
epoch
1
period
163
block
330048
offset
1115674822
timestamp
2014-11-14 23:40:52 UTC
rarity
common
prev
next